To keep things tidy and straightforward, use geometric forms for each part of the body, such as spheres, cylinders, squares, etc. There is an additional degree of difficulty because the person's arm is foreshortened. Because of this, it is crucial that we sketch every component precisely before increasing the difficulty. The primary issue was not adopting the proper viewpoint. To properly create it, you can utilize a variety of tools, such as the Asaro head or the Loomis approach. The character has a powerful foreshortening arm in front of them while moving with their fingers. If these stances are not executed correctly, the drawing will fall apart with just one line. To gain a sense of how much we truly perceive when we overlap elements, I suggest that you start by tracing some of it from references. The movement of the hands is another piece of advice.
